Fairmont-Marion County Transit Authority (FMCTA) helps the citizens of Marion County get to work, medical appointments, and even to shopping centers. We do everything possible to get our passengers where they need to be when they need to be there. We offer several services to meet your transportation needs: routes, Flex, paratransit, Dial-A-Ride, and non-emergency medical transportation. We operate Monday-Friday. Limited service is available on Saturday. Come ride with us!

Thank You for Your Support of the Levy

Each year more than 100,000 riders depend on transit services provided by FMCTA. Without your support of the levy, FMCTA would not be able to connect our citizens, seniors and disabled people to work, school, shopping and doctor’s appointments. We thank you for your continued support of the levy and FMCTA.
